Animation critic Charles Solomon reviews The Incredibles, the latest computer-animated film from Pixar. The highly anticipated film opens in U.S. theaters Friday.
Copyright 2004 NPR
Animation critic Charles Solomon reviews The Incredibles, the latest computer-animated film from Pixar. The highly anticipated film opens in U.S. theaters Friday.
Copyright 2004 NPR